Read or download asset classes benchmark indexes replicating funds data to perform advanced portfolio analysis operations by installing related packages and running code on Python PyCharm IDE.
Compare asset classes benchmark indexes replicating funds returns and risks tradeoffs for fixed income or bonds and equities or stocks.
Estimate asset classes expected returns through historical annualized returns and risks through historical returns annualized standard deviation.
Calculate portfolios Sharpe ratios performance metrics.
Estimate benchmark global portfolio returns from periodically rebalanced equal weighted assets allocation.
